Output 51291355598aae87f617ef574d7463885e01d53b7ef499cc358eac0a3a8ff50d:6

value
690020471
script pubkey
OP_0 OP_PUSHBYTES_20 583bc4f072e650ee16cb88b6be111fa745c3d646
address
bc1qtqaufurjuegwu9kt3zmtuygl5azu84jxtnq5g5
transaction
51291355598aae87f617ef574d7463885e01d53b7ef499cc358eac0a3a8ff50d
spent
true